REPLACE BOILERS is a federal award for Naval Air Warfare Center held by Four Tribes Construction Services, LLC. Estimated value $606K ($606K obligated). Current period of performance ends Oct 31, 2026. Place of performance: RIDGECREST CA. Related solicitation N6893620R0132.
